Örebro SK strengthen defense with loan signing of Giuseppe Bovalina Örebro SK have officially confirmed the loan signing of defender Giuseppe Bovalina from Vancouver Whitecaps FC. The deal runs through 2026 and will bolster the squad in Superettan, where they currently sit 14th with 15 points from 16 games (3 wins, 6 draws, 7 losses). Giuseppe Bovalina, 21, arrives from Adelaide United FC in the A-League and has made 24 appearances and 2 assists for Vancouver. He is an Australian youth international and is considered a promising defensive talent.
What does this mean for Örebro SK? The loan of Bovalina will provide Örebro SK with an extra dimension in defense. With 22 goals conceded and a goal difference of -9, the team needs reinforcements to stay competitive in Superettan. Bovalina will be ready to make his debut in the next match against IFK Värnamo, who are 15th in the table.
